Output 6e53132c6e5e98cef355b2336e71e94de4b07635c4ee301aa83628b336c4c020:0

value
7443285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75fcf3f296225e661e8902503451427a2b3a4608 OP_EQUAL
address
3CSt1TvJEq9PUcaeX7WPjMUKKno8UCGSGE
transaction
6e53132c6e5e98cef355b2336e71e94de4b07635c4ee301aa83628b336c4c020
confirmations
410355
spent
true